We live on the flat coastal plain near Victory Park. Does the soil type affect our home's electrical safety?

Yes, terrain directly impacts grounding. The sandy, well-drained soils common here can have higher resistance, which may compromise the effectiveness of your grounding electrode system. During a fault, proper grounding is essential for safety. An electrician should perform a ground resistance test to ensure your rods meet NEC 2023 requirements, especially for older homes where the original installation may have degraded.

My smart home devices keep resetting during storms near the shore. Is this a JCP&L grid issue?

Coastal storms on the JCP&L grid create moderate surge risk from nearby lightning strikes and tree contact. These voltage spikes can easily bypass basic power strips. Modern electronics with sensitive microprocessors need layered protection. A whole-house surge protector installed at your main panel is the professional solution to safeguard your investment from these transient events.

My Rumson home has overhead lines coming to a mast on the roof. What are common issues with this setup?

Overhead service masts are exposed to the elements. Common issues include masthead damage from falling branches, corrosion at the weatherhead, and outdated mast sizing that doesn't meet modern cable requirements. We also check the utility's service drop cable for wear. Ensuring this entrance equipment is robust is critical, as it's the first point of contact for power from JCP&L's poles.

How should I prepare my Rumson home's electrical system for summer brownouts and winter ice storms?

Summer AC peaks strain the grid, while winter ice can bring down lines. For brownouts, ensure your critical circuits are on an automatic transfer switch connected to a properly sized generator. This prevents damage from low voltage. For storm preparedness, that whole-house surge protector is crucial, and having an electrician verify your grounding electrode system's integrity is a key safety check.

I have a Federal Pacific panel and want to add an EV charger. Is my 100-amp service from 1966 safe for this?

No, it is not. Federal Pacific panels have a known failure rate and are considered a fire hazard, requiring replacement before any major upgrade. Furthermore, a 1966-era 100A service lacks the capacity for a Level 2 EV charger or a modern heat pump. A full service upgrade to 200A is the necessary, code-compliant foundation for these high-demand systems.
